    I knew the story of a woman getting killed by one of the umbrellas just above Dead Man’s Curve on the Grapevine, and I think about it every time I drive past. The film covers the tragedy, but glosses over the second death by electrocution, which happened during the deinstallation of the umbrellas in japan, probably because the filmmakers had ceased filming by then. It is just terrible that an artwork so profoundly irrational caused two deaths.
